ABOUT THE ARTIST

Ohara Koson (1877-1945) was a Japanese artist known for his woodblock prints and paintings, primarily focusing on nature, landscapes, and birds. He was part of the shin-hanga ("new prints") movement, which revitalized traditional Japanese woodblock printing techniques during the early 20th century. Koson's prints often featured birds, flowers, and natural scenes, showcasing his meticulous attention to detail and mastery of color and composition. He gained particular acclaim for his beautiful and delicately rendered bird prints, depicting various species in their natural habitats.
